An ongoing full-time Facilities Maintenance Trade Overseer 5D role at the Silverwater Correctional Complex in NSW offers a salary of $94,456 per year plus incidental allowance, annual leave loading and superannuation. You will supervise and develop inmate teams, coaching and instructing them to lift work skills and post-release prospects while ensuring productivity, WHS, quality management and customer service standards. The successful candidate will receive paid training to undertake the Certificate III in Correctional Practice. Essential requirements include proven post-trade experience, relevant trade qualifications and a current NSW driver's license; willingness to work across trades and participate in an after-hours on-call roster is required.
